Virginia Willis of Atlanta, who has taught cooking classes in Columbus, will be a "chef-testant" on "Chopped" tonight at 10 p.m. on the Food Network.
"Chopped" pits four chefs against each other as they each cook an appetizer, entree and dessert using every ingredient in a basket given to them before each course. After each course is judged by a panel, one chef is eliminated.
The chefs compete for $10,000 and the opportunity to go to the next round of "Chopped."
Willis is a trained chef and has written cookbooks, including "Bon Appetit, Y'all: Recipes and Stories from Three Generations of Southern Cooking," "Basic to Brilliant, Y'all: 150 Refined Southern Recipes" and "Ways to Dress Them up for Company."
The Chicago Tribune called her "Seven Food Writers You Need to Know." She is also a contributing editor for Southern Living magazine.
